Hidden human computers [electronic resource] : the black women of NASA / by Sue Bradford Edwards and Duchess Harris, JD, PHD.

Discusses how in the 1950s, black women made critical contributions to NASA by performing calculations that made it possible for the nation's astronauts to fly into space and return safely to Earth.-- Edwards and Harris discuss the critical contributions black women made to NASA in the 1950s.
